1. Constantly Making Eye Contact
You feel something lurking, eyes piercing on you… oh, it’s just your shadow dog making sure they have a glimpse of you no matter where you are in the house. Some dogs like to be able to keep you in eyes view because of their protective instincts and you are the thing they hold most precious.
2. Resting Their Heads on You
Even the most independent dogs have their moments where they want to be close with their fur moms and dads. So, if your dog rests his head on you while you watch TV or read a book on the couch, then he is expressing his love for you.
3. Waking You Up With Kisses
Sometimes I wake up with a paw to the face or bark to let me know its breakfast time. But *sometimes* I get woken up with gentle licks and cuddles with no urgency to get up. These quiet moments send a message that can only be relayed as 1 thing- I love you. So, if your dog often wakes you up with licks and cuddles, they are in love with you.


4. Bringing You Gifts
Did your dog bring a stick, a leaf, a blanket, a dead rat to you? While it may seem meaningless to you, dogs will often retrieve special items and bring them to your feet as a way to say, I love you. The things they bring might not be important for you, but for your dog, it is special. So, appreciate your dog, when they retrieve something for you.
5. Smiling
Smiling is the ultimate expression for being content. When dogs smile, this indicates that they are living one of the happiest moments of their lives. And if they stare at your while smiling, they are saying I love you. After all, all we want is for our pets to feel love and be happy right?
